    Kiwi, are you just talking about an oil change on the Primary ?
    If so, don't worry too much about a torque wrench, just dont be heavy handed.
    You can buy 1/4" drive Torx bit's quite cheaply, and even a 1/4" drive Torque Wrench is only about $80
    for a cheaper unit like Kincrome, which will do the job.
